All Skills In The Sims 4 And How To Improve Them
One of the core pieces of gameplay in The Sims 4 is skills--you know, the stuff that your sims are good at. As it is in our world, there are tons of skills that every sim can hypothetically learn over the course of their lives, and every new expansion adds a small pile of new ones. It can be a lot to keep track of; even folks who've been playing The Sims 4 since launch have probably forgotten about some of these. There are more than four dozen skills that adult sims are able to learn at this point, and that's not even counting the many Sims 4 mods that add more.Every skill in The Sims 4 has related activities that you can do to learn them, but there are also universal methods. There are several aspiration rewards you can take that will make your sim gain skills faster--Night Owl and Morning Sim will increase your skill gains at night and in the morning, respectively, and Savant will give you a 25% boost to all skill gains permanently.Every skill also has corresponding skill books you can read to jumpstart your skill gains, though you won't be able to max out any skill just by reading about it--learning theory will only take you so far.
